Opplysninger | Le Corbusier ws the twentieth century's most significant architect. His innovative houses, including Villas La Roche-Jeanneret, Villa Savoye, Maison Curutchet, and Maison de l'Homme, are icons of modernism and monuments to his quest to forge new ways of living. Yet, until now, only faded drawings of uneven size and quality have been available for study. Le Corbusier Redrawn: The Houses presents the first consistently rendered collection of plans, sections, and elevations of the master architect's residential projects, together with 120 remarkable sectional perspectives based on original drawings from Le Corbusier Foundation's digital archives. Architect Steven Park's new compositions and interior spaces, while accompanying text traces the progression of Le Corbusier's theories and techniques, from his machine-inspired white villas through later dwellings that reinterpreted ancient and vernacular forms and methods. Le Corbusier Redrawn: The Houses is an essential tool for comprehending the ideas and works of this pivotal figure in the history of modern architecture
